WebSievert ’s (square root) law states that, at a given temperature, the solubility of a diatomic gas in a melt changes with the square root of its pressure. WebPalladium and palladium alloy membranes are superior materials for hydrogen purification, removal, or reaction processes. Sieverts’ Law suggests that the flux of hydrogen through such membranes is proportional to the difference between the feed and permeate side partial pressures, each raised to the 0.5 power (n = 0.5).Sieverts’ Law is widely applied in … WebSep 12, 2024 · Newton’s Third Law of Motion.
